// MAX_PARITY_DRIFT_BPS: widest allowed gap (basis points) between our
// published rate and any partner channel before RateSentry flags a
// parity breach for the Hollowpine hotel group.
// Do not lower below 25 — the Ferngate feed rounds to whole currency
// units and will spam false positives.
// Raising above 120 effectively disables the checker; legal asked us
// not to do that after the Marlow audit.
// Changing this constant requires regenerating the golden fixtures.
// The fixture set was generated against the build stamped below.

pipeline stamp: htk21_104c5ba7d0df6b2897cd5

**Q: Why is the side-entrance sensor taped over?**

A: The Ferris Gate door sensors at Oakline Plaza are subject to a manufacturer recall and have been disabled while replacements are fitted. Visiting contractors should use the keypad beside the frame instead of badging in. Please close the door firmly behind you, as it will not auto-latch. The temporary keypad code is below.

staff pass of kawip-hawef = bdg-QLP-2

Handover note — Crumbwheel order cutoffs.

Welcome aboard. The bakery cutoff rule in Crumbwheel closes same-day orders at 14:00 local to each storefront, not UTC — this has bitten us twice. Holiday overrides live in the calendar service and take precedence silently, so always check there first when a cutoff looks wrong. To unlock the calendar service's admin console after a restart, enter the recovery passphrase below.

vault phrase of bagap-bahaf = silion-pelox-sorox-casdor-quenwyn-fraax-eliox-praael-kelion-quenvan-kasox-rusael-norius-belvan